After a freak accident with Professor Farnsworth's Time Rifle, Leela is blown to past, present, and future bits, dividing her into her toddler, teen, and elderly selves. Any way you look at it, there's a whole lotta Leela going on.

Fun story, great comic-based sequel to the awesome-age episode "Teenage Mutant Leela's Hurdles". I found that elderly Leela gave me the most laughs, especially when she mistakes Bender for her kettle. The space/time continuum tearing was a great climax, and love Fry's reaction when Teenage Leela discovers that he already knew of the tearing ("I'd just ordered another hot apple fritter"). The only sad thing was the art, let down in places by Mike Kazaleh's untrustworthy hand.
8/10
